In the recent environment of low rate of interest prices, some MYGA investors construct "ladders." That implies buying multiple annuities with staggered terms.
If you opened MYGAs of 3-, 4-, 5- and 6-year terms, you would have an account developing every year after 3 years. At the end of the term, your money might be taken out or taken into a brand-new annuity-- with good luck, at a greater rate. You can likewise utilize MYGAs in ladders with fixed-indexed annuities, a technique that seeks to optimize return while also protecting principal.

Annuity prices are difficult to compare because, as formerly mentioned, different types of annuities make rate of interest in various ways. Traditional fixed annuities ensure a rate of interest price for a 1 year term, whereas various other taken care of annuities like MYGAs ensure prices for 3 to 10 years.
Whereas, the fixed index annuity employs distinct attributing techniques based upon the performance of a stock market index. Contrasting annuity kinds can be complicated to the typical customer. Fixed annuities, consisting of MYGAs, gain interest at an established rate for a guaranteed period. These are one of the most uncomplicated annuity enters terms of passion prices.

Immediate annuities, also understood as revenue annuities or single premium prompt annuities, convert premiums to a stream of income instantaneously. This does not imply that the annuitant needs to start receiving earnings settlements right away. Deferred income annuities (DIAs) are annuitized promptly, however payments start at a specific future day.
The buildup period is the 3rd container annuity service providers use to identify these products. Immediate annuities have no build-up period. The sole objective of an instant annuity is to generate a surefire earnings stream. Deferred annuities, on the other hand, have an accumulation period during which interest is credited according to the agreement.
The rates of interest for indexed and variable annuities fluctuate with the stock market. Consequently, individuals that purchase among these annuity types must examine either the variable annuity program or the method options and price sheet for the particular indexed item they are acquiring. Income annuities (FIAs and DIAs) are generally priced estimate using either the month-to-month earnings payment amount or a yearly payout rate that represents the percent of the costs amount that the annuitant has actually obtained in revenue repayments.

This is as a result of the way insurance firms purchase annuity costs to generate returns. Insurance firms' taken care of annuity profiles are composed of fairly safe investments like bonds. So, when rate of interest on bonds and comparable products climb as they did throughout much of 2023 the greater returns insurance providers receive from their profiles are passed to consumers as more charitable repaired annuity rates.
According to Limra, fixed annuity sales last year totaled $140 billion, with rates tripling over 18 months going back to 2022. "If passion prices go up, it's expected annuities will pay more," Branislav Nikolic, the Vice President of Research Study at CANNEX, informed CNBC.
